vb访问oracle9的clob字段
vb访问oracle9的clob字段,不稳定,偶尔会出错,牛X人给看看!!!!!错误提示如下: Unable to make connection,ora-00604:error occurred at recursibe SQL level 1 ora-00001:unique constraint (sysgem.sys_c0042814) violated ora-06512:at line 3 代码如下: Set rn = New ADODB.Connection '本段专门用来处理CLOB字段的 With rn .ConnectionString = "Provider=OraOledb.Oracle.1;Password=" & kl & "; User ID=" & yhm & "; Data Source=" & sjk & ";Locale Identifier=2052" .Open End With Dim rs As New ADODB.Recordset rs.ActiveConnection = rn rs.LockType = adLockOptimistic rs.CursorLocation = adUseClient rs.Source = "select sgt from " & tname1 & " where jh='" & dy5("jh") & "' and to_char(csrq,'yyyy-mm-dd')='" & Format$(dy5("csrq"), "yyyy-mm-dd") & "'" rs.Open If Not (rs.BOF And rs.EOF) Then dy5("sgt") = rs.Fields("sgt") End If Set rs = Nothing
是不是你的yhm 和sjk 和kl是不是没有初始化?这个过程你写在什么里面了?
答:大家知道,超过4000字的文本一般存储在CLOB中(MSQL、Sysbase是存放在Text中),在目前的Oracle版本(Oracle8i)中,对大字段CLO...详情>>
答:线性链表分好几种,分为单链,双链等,它们的存储顺序也不一样. 线性表是顺序存储的,占顺序的存储空间详情>>
问:电脑安装了VB6.0,为什么打开方式里面没有VB程序选项,进安装好的VB里去关联...
答:打开方式最下面还有一个《选择程序》,点开后查VB的安装目录的EXE,找到后直接打开,下次就会在打开方式里查到了详情>>